Acadia Gateway Center - free shuttle service to attractions such as Bar Harbor & Acadia National Park
Where to Get Picked Up: The Island Explorer shuttle bus pickup zone is located directly outside the front doors of the main 11,000-square-foot welcome building. Inside, guests can also buy park passes, use the restrooms, and grab physical maps.
Shuttle Maps & Times: The fare-free buses generally run every 30 minutes. Guests can find full timetables, route maps, and a live bus tracker directly via the Island Explorer Route Finder
